Dr. Shane Roche is a Consultant in General (Internal) Medicine, whose current post is Imperial College Healthcare Trust. His areas of specialism include geriatric and general medicine, stroke, dizzy spells, falls, frailty and rehabilitation and dementia and memory impairment. He has many areas of clinical interest and is trained to treat patients with complex needs, he is recommended to treat older patients. Dr. Roche has over 20 years' experience. His aim is to achieve a smooth patient pathway and he is thus very efficient in communicating very quickly with GPs and other healthcare professionals, resulting in successful treatment.
Dr. Roche qualified as a doctor in Dublin in 1980 and moved to London in 1985 to complete his training at Charing Cross, St Mary’s Hospital and Central Middlesex. He currently works under the Imperial College Healthcare Trust, as well as leading a Community Rehabilitation unit for the elderly. As an active member of the research community, he has authored numerous published articles, on Parkinson’s and Dementia in particular.
